Suplementação da dieta de novilhos de três grupos genéticos em pastagem de Brachiaria brizantha cv. Marandu

Freitas, Djalma de [UNESP] 18 February 2005 (has links) (PDF)
Made available in DSpace on 2014-06-11T19:33:33Z (GMT). No. of bitstreams: 0 Previous issue date: 2005-02-18Bitstream added on 2014-06-13T19:44:26Z : No. of bitstreams: 1 freitas_d_dr_jab.pdf: 289499 bytes, checksum: c5915810c01ae6ff83c29af684cb57ea (MD5) / Fundação de Amparo à Pesquisa do Estado de São Paulo (FAPESP) / Foram utilizados 18 animais dos grupos genéticos: Nelore (N), Nelore x Red Angus (NRed) e mestiços leiteiro (ML). O manejo da pastagem foi em sistema rotacionado e as seguintes quantidades de suplementos foram utilizadas: 0,6% do PV (19/06/02 a 21/11/02); 0,2 %; 0,6 % e 1,0 % do PV (20/12/02 a 17/05/03) e 0,4 %; 0,8 % e 1,2% (18/05/03 a 18/08/03). O delineamento utilizado para o desempenho animal foi em blocos casualizados, em esquema fatorial (3x3), com seis repetições. Para a avaliação de carcaça utilizou-se o delineamento inteiramente casualizado em arranjo fatorial 3x3 (3 grupos genéticos (GG) e 3 planos nutricionais, (PN)). Os valores de ganho de peso vivo (GPV), no primeiro período, foram de 0,79; 0,73 e 0,61 kg/dia, para os animais NRed, ML e N, respectivamente, com diferença entre os GG (P<0,05). O maior GPV permitiu aos animais NRed menor tempo (P<0,05) até o abate (310 dias), comparados aos animais N e ML com 402 e 389 dias, respectivamente. Os animais submetidos ao PN1 apresentaram menor (P<0,05) peso de abate (450,5 kg) em comparação ao PN2 e PN3, que foram iguais (465,0 e 463,1 kg). Para tecido comestível (TC), ossos e relação TC:Ossos não houve diferença entre os PN avaliados. O rendimento de carcaça dos animais ML foi inferior (P<0,05) ao dos N e NRed, com valores de 53,0; 56,6 e 55,5 %, respectivamente. Apesar do menor rendimento de carcaça, os animais ML proporcionaram o maior retorno financeiro/animal (R$/boi). O diferencial entre o preço da @ de entrada e saída determinou o resultado. O componente individual de maior importância nos custos foi a aquisição do animal, representando 59,9 % nos NRed, 50,7 nos N e 40,1% nos ML. / Eighteen steers from three genetic groups (Nellore-N, Nellore x Red Angus-NRed or dairy crossbreed-DC) were evaluated in pasture managed in a rotational system. Amounts of supplemental feed were: 0.6% LW (06/19/02 to 11/21/02); 0.2%, 0.6% and 1.0% LW (12/20/02 to 05/17/03) and 0.4%, 0.8% and 1.2% (05/18/03 to 08/18/03). For performance evaluation, steers were arranged according to a randomized blocks in factorial scheme 3x3 with six replications. For carcass evaluation, a completely randomized design was used with a factorial scheme 3x3 (3 genetic groups (GG) and 3 nutritional plans (NP)). In the first period, the three genetic groups were different (P<0.05) in terms of daily live weight gain (LWG), being the means of 0.79, 0.73 and 0.61 kg for NRed, ML and N groups, respectively. The higher LWG of NRed steers permitted them to be slaughtered earlier (P<0.05) (310 days) than N and ML steers (402 and 389 days, respectively). Steers submitted to NP1 were lighter (P<0.05) at slaughter (450.5 kg) than those from NP2 and NP3, which showed similar weights (465.0 and 463.1 kg, respectively). The three NP evaluated were similar in relation to comestible tissue (CT), bones and CT:Bone ratio. Carcass yield of DC steers was smaller (P<0.05) than those of N and NRed steers, being the means 53.0; 56.6 and 55.5%, respectively. Instead of the smaller carcass yield, the DC steers proportioned the better financial recovering per animal (R$/steer). The difference between the prices of entered and exited @ determined the result. The main individual component of costs is the animal purchase price, which was represented by 59.9%, 50.7% and 40.1% in NRed, N and ML groups, respectively.

Plan de negocio de un restaurante de comida saludable para personas que necesiten y desean cuidar su alimentación / Business plan of a healthy food restaurant for people who need and want to take care of their diet

Alva Peña, Kathia Liliana, Vallejo Espinoza, Paolo Sergio, Valverde Sanez, Manuel Saúl 25 November 2021 (has links)
El presente trabajo de investigación tiene como objetivo evaluar la deseabilidad, factibilidad comercial y la viabilidad financiera de crear e implementar un restaurante especializado en comida saludable para personas que necesiten cuidar su alimentación para controlar enfermedades no trasmisibles (diabetes, hipertensión, obesidad y otros). El plan de negocio contiene el análisis de mercado teniendo en cuenta las tendencias mundiales que muestran un crecimiento sostenido por el interés de mantener una vida saludable a través de una alimentación sana. El restaurante va dirigido a personas con enfermedades no transmisibles con NSE A y B, mayores de 18 años con poder adquisitivo, modernas, progresistas y sofisticadas que priorizan su alimentación con cuidados nutricionales. Adicionalmente, se realizó un sondeo de mercado a fin de poder identificar información necesaria que valida y ayuda definir el modelo de negocio. El restaurante estará ubicado en Miraflores, el cual funcionará brindando almuerzos y cenas. La carta será diseñada y supervisada por un Chef altamente calificado y un nutricionista especializado. Para el inicio de las operaciones se necesitará una inversión de s/ 541,073 dicho monto se utilizará en la compra de equipos y capital de trabajo. La estructura de capital estará distribuida con 60% de deuda y 40% de capital propio teniendo una relación D/E de 1.5. Finalmente, luego de realizar el análisis financiero se obtiene un VAN de s/ 271,680 y una TIR de 32% considerando una tasa de descuento del 13.65%, por lo que se concluye que el proyecto es rentable, viable y genera valor. / The present research work aims to evaluate the desirability, commercial feasibility and financial viability of creating and implementing a restaurant specialized in healthy food with special attention to people who want to take care of their diet to control non-communicable diseases (diabetes, hypertension, obesity and others). The proposed business contains the market analysis considering world trends that show sustained growth in the interest of maintaining a healthy life through healthy eating. The restaurant is aimed at people with non-communicable diseases with NSE A and B, over 18 years of age with purchasing power, modern, progressive and sophisticated who prioritize their diet with nutritional care. In addition, a market survey was carried out in order to identify necessary information that validates and helps define the business model. The restaurant will be in Miraflores, which will operate providing lunch and dinner. The menu will be designed and supervised by a highly qualified Chef and a specialized nutritionist. For the start of operations, an investment of s / 541,073 will be needed. This amount will be used for the purchase of equipment and working capital. The capital structure will be distributed with 60% debt and 40% equity, having a D / E ratio of 1.5. Finally, after carrying out the financial analysis, a NPV of s / 271,680 is obtained and an IRR of 32% considering a discount rate of 13.65%, which is why it is concluded that the project is profitable, viable and generates value. / Trabajo de investigación
